Population in Sulechów Municipality 2023
In 2023, Sulechów municipality ranked 232 of 2,478 Polish municipalities. Population shrank by 606 residents -2.28% between 2018-2023, at 25,982.
Among 1984 declining municipalities, in top 40% for steepest decline. Within Zielonogórski county, ranked 1 of 9 municipalities.
Based on 31 years of official GUS statistics for Zielonogórski county municipalities within Lubusz province.
